Understanding Automatic Hoovers
Automatic hoovers are basically self-operating vacuum cleaners created to clean floorings without requiring user intervention. They are equipped with a range of sensors, cams, and wise technology that allow them to browse around barriers, detect dirt, and go back to their docking stations when the battery is low. Most designs feature companion apps that allow users to control the device from another location and personalize cleansing schedules.
Secret Features of Automatic Hoovers
Smart Navigation: Using sensors, electronic cameras, or even advanced mapping innovation, automatic hoovers can smartly traverse your home, avoiding furniture and other obstacles.

Set up Cleaning: Users can set schedules for when the vacuum need to operate, so cleaning up can take place while you're away.

Automatic Charging: When the battery runs low, the hoover immediately goes back to its charging station, getting rid of the requirement for manual charging.

Several Cleaning Modes: Many automatic hoovers offer specialized modes for various surface areas and cleaning up requirements, such as spot cleaning, edge cleansing, and deep cleaning.

High-Efficiency Filters: Most models consist of filters that can record small particles, making them suitable for allergy patients.

Frequently Asked QuestionsQ1: Are automatic hoovers worth the investment?
A1: While the preliminary investment may appear high, lots of users find that the time conserved and benefit provided by automatic hoovers justify the cost in the long run.
Q2: How often should I run my automatic hoover?
A2: The frequency depends on your household's size and requirements. Many owners run their automatic hoovers daily or numerous times a week, specifically in homes with pets.
Q3: Can automatic hoovers efficiently tidy carpets?
A3: Yes, numerous models are designed to deal with both carpets and difficult floorings. However, particular models may perform much better on particular types of surfaces.
Q4: How do I preserve my automatic hoover?
A4: Regularly empty the dust bin, tidy the brushes and filters, and examine for obstructions or clogs. Describe the manufacturer's directions for particular upkeep ideas.
Q5: Can I manage my automatic hoover with a smartphone?
A5: Many modern automatic vacuum cleaners hoovers have buddy apps that allow for push-button control, scheduling, and real-time monitoring.
